Как организованы серверные операционные системы
Как организованы серверные операционные системы
Серверные операционные системы составляют собой специфическое программное обеспечение для регулирования физическими ресурсами компьютера. Структура таких систем основывается на принципе многозадачности и многопользовательского доступа. Ядро координирует работу процессора, операционной памяти, дисковых накопителей и сетевых интерфейсов.
Основу составляет модульная архитектура, где каждый блок реализует установленные функции. Драйверы обеспечивают связь с реальным техникой. Планировщик задач делит вычислительные ресурсы между потоками. Файловая система упорядочивает хранение информации на накопителях.
Серверная вавада включает модули для обслуживания сетевых соединений и старта программ. Системные библиотеки предоставляют процессам подготовленные операции для работы с возможностями. Механизмы разделения задач блокируют столкновения между процессами.
Интерфейс командной строки обеспечивает операторам регулировать настройки и проверять статус системы. Журналы событий записывают сведения о работе блоков вавада казино зеркало. Такая конфигурация гарантирует надежную функционирование оборудования под значительной загрузкой.
Чем серверная ОС различается от обычной
Ключевое отличие состоит в предназначении и методе использования. Настольные системы заточены на функционирование одного оператора с графическими приложениями. Серверные системы поддерживают массу параллельных коннектов и выполняют фоновые задачи без взаимодействия человека.
Графический интерфейс в серверных модификациях нередко недоступен или сокращен. Управление производится через командную строку и настроечные файлы. Такой способ уменьшает потребление возможностей и улучшает быстродействие. Настольные варианты дают визуальные утилиты для обычных действий.
Серверные платформы предоставляют расширенные возможности роста. Платформы vavada оперируют с огромными объемами памяти и множеством процессорных ядер. Стабильность и постоянство работы критически существенны для серверного программного обеспечения. Системы разрабатываются для круглосуточного действия без перезагрузок. Системы резервирования предохраняют от сбоев. Пользовательские варианты терпят регулярные перезагрузки и менее притязательны к устойчивости.
Основные задания серверных систем
Серверные решения выполняют спектр целей по гарантированию деятельности сетевых услуг и приложений:
- Выполнение входящих сетевых коннектов и маршрутизация трафика.
- Активация и надзор функционирования пользовательских приложений и веб-сервисов.
- Выделение расчетной ресурсов между запущенными потоками.
- Мониторинг статуса физических блоков и софтверных модулей.
- Ведение логов событий для исследования быстродействия.
Программное обеспечение организует взаимодействие между клиентскими машинами и процессорными средствами. Архитектура дает синхронно осуществлять тысячи запросов от разных операторов.
Размещение и контроль информацией образует центральную роль серверных решений. Файловые хранилища обеспечивают подключение к документам, медиафайлам и резервам. Системы управления базами данных выполняют организованную сведения. Средства backup дублирования оберегают значимые информацию от пропажи.
Система обеспечивает обособление пользовательских сред и программ. Виртуализация позволяет запускать ряд обособленных казино вавада на одном реальном компьютере. Выравнивание нагрузки выделяет операции между свободными ресурсами для эффективной эффективности.
Как осуществляются обращения клиентов
Процесс выполнения инициируется с получения запроса через сетевой интерфейс. Входящее подключение помещается в список, где ждет своей черед. Сетевой уровень обрабатывает блоки данных и выявляет нужный сервис. Маршрутизатор пересылает запрос соответствующему софтверному компоненту.
Сервис получает информацию и реализует требуемые действия. Приложение может запросить к файловой системе для считывания или записи сведений. База данных отдает затребованные данные. Расчетные процедуры осуществляются процессором в соответствии с первоочередности процесса.
Многопотоковая конструкция обеспечивает выполнять массу запросов параллельно. Каждое подключение обретает выделенный поток выполнения. Планировщик распределяет процессорное время между запущенными процессами. Серверная вавада отслеживает расход памяти и блокирует переполнение возможностей.
Подготовленный отклик отправляется обратно клиенту через сетевое подключение. Протоколы транспортного яруса обеспечивают доставку сведений. Лог записывает информацию о выполненной задаче и статусе окончания. Освобожденные ресурсы делаются готовыми для новых обращений.
Контроль ресурсами и нагруженностью
Рациональное выделение ресурсов обеспечивает надежную функционирование всех служб. Диспетчер процессов определяет приоритеты задач и отдает процессорное время. Механизмы распределения блокируют перегрузку индивидуальных блоков. Контроль отслеживает настоящее состояние техники в настоящем времени.
Оперативная память разносится между запущенными приложениями динамически. Средство виртуализации эксплуатирует накопительное место при нехватке физической памяти. Кэширование увеличивает обращение к часто запрашиваемым сведениям. Самостоятельная сборка высвобождает неиспользуемые сегменты памяти.
Дисковые действия оптимизируются через очереди запросов и упреждающее считывание. Файловая система кластеризует ассоциированные информацию для снижения времени подключения. Серверные vavada поддерживают живую замену накопителей без остановки деятельности.
Сетевая модуль отслеживает передающую емкость путей передачи. Ограничение пропускной способности блокирует захват bandwidth отдельными соединениями. Ранжирование потока гарантирует уровень предоставления важных модулей. Метрики нагруженности способствует проектировать развитие инфраструктуры.
Безопасность и управление входа
Обеспечение сведений и средств основывается на иерархической структуре разграничения полномочий. Каждый оператор обретает индивидуальный идентификатор и комплект разрешений. Аутентификация проверяет достоверность регистрационных записей при входе. Пароли содержатся в криптованном формате для предотвращения запрещенного проникновения.
Разрешения доступа к документам и директориям настраиваются индивидуально для каждого элемента. Собственник ресурса назначает допустимые действия для других клиентов. Коллективы объединяют пользовательские записи с схожими разрешениями. Серверная казино вавада блокирует попытки выполнения неразрешенных действий.
Сетевой фаервол отсеивает поступающий и исходящий данные по установленным условиям. Списки контроля сужают соединения с указанных IP-адресов. Системы обнаружения атак анализируют аномальную активность. Кодирование оберегает пересылаемую данные от кражи.
Протоколы безопасности сохраняют все старания обращения к ограниченным ресурсам. Аудит событий содействует определить нарушения политики. Самостоятельные уведомления информируют администраторов о критических происшествиях. Систематическое изменение критериев приспосабливает систему к современным угрозам.
Деятельность с сетью и коннектами
Сетевая компонент гарантирует коммуникацию сервера с удаленными терминалами и другими узлами. Сетевые интерфейсы получают и транслируют сведения по множественным форматам. Драйверы карт контролируют аппаратными разъемами. Установка IP-адресов определяет опознание машины в сети.
Набор протоколов TCP/IP выполняет пересылку сведений на разных слоях. Перенаправление передает фрагменты к конечным узлам через эффективные маршруты. DNS-резолвер преобразует доменные названия в numeric адреса. DHCP самостоятельно назначает сетевые настройки присоединенным аппаратам.
Регулирование подключениями включает контроль активных сессий и таймаутов. Группы коннектов вторично задействуют установленные пути для сохранения ресурсов. Серверные вавада поддерживают тысячи синхронных TCP-соединений благодаря оптимальным схемам. Балансеры разносят входящий поток между разными хостами.
Наблюдение сетевой поведения отслеживает транспортную способность и лаги. Тестовые утилиты контролируют доступность удаленных серверов. Статистика интерфейсов показывает размеры отправленных сведений и объем отказов. Установка кэшей повышает скорость при разнообразных видах загрузки.
Патчи и поддержание системы
Регулярное актуализация программного обеспечения предоставляет охрану и надежность функционирования. Разработчики издают исправления для ликвидации дыр и неисправностей. Системы пакетов упрощают скачивание и установку патчей. Администраторы организуют использование изменений в промежутки слабой загрузки.
Проверка обновлений на отдельных окружениях предотвращает непредвиденные неполадки. Резервное копирование конфигурации обеспечивает моментально вернуть корректировки при сбоях. Серверная vavada обеспечивает системы возврата к ранним релизам элементов.
Наблюдение положения контролирует доступность свежих редакций утилит и библиотек. Оповещения извещают о важных патчах безопасности. Автоматизированные сканирования определяют старые элементы. Правила актуализации определяют важности и периоды применения правок.
Техническая поддержка производителей обеспечивает советы по настраиванию и ликвидации сбоев. Группа клиентов делится навыками реализации проблем. Базы информации предоставляют указания по конфигурированию. Платные соглашения гарантируют доступ апдейтов в продолжение заданного периода.
Где эксплуатируются серверные операционные системы
Веб-хостинг составляет одну из главных зон эксплуатации серверных систем. Компании развертывают ресурсы и веб-приложения на физических или облачных узлах. Системы обрабатывают HTTP-запросы от миллионов пользователей каждодневно.
Предприятийные сети строятся на серверную архитектуру для сохранения данных и старта бизнес-приложений. Файловые серверы обеспечивают единый обращение к файлам. Почтовые решения выполняют сообщения фирмы. Базы данных содержат информацию о заказчиках и денежных действиях.
Облачные поставщики выстраивают масштабируемые системы на основе серверных платформ. Виртуализация дает формировать отдельные окружения для множественных заказчиков. Серверные казино вавада предоставляют адаптивность и результативность облачных служб.
Научные операции требуют производительных серверных ферм для обработки значительных объемов данных. Исследовательские институты воспроизводят трудные механизмы. Медицинские учреждения хранят цифровые записи пациентов на охраняемых узлах. Обучающие порталы предоставляют подключение к обучающим материалам.